Operations CXO Status Report

Saturday 10/16/99 8:00am EST

During the last 24 hours Chandra completed the GTO observation of the Southern Deep Field with ACIS-I and entered the radiation belts. The ACIS FEP's and video boards were powered down by real-time commanding prior to belt entry. This procedure will be performed by the on-board loads for future passages to ensure a full reset of the FEPs.

Further assessment of data from front-end-processor (FEP)-0 of ACIS indicated that the unit has been producing an increased number of parity errors intermittently over the last few days and observations with ACIS will be made without use of this FEP while engineering analysis is being conducted. The ACIS parameter blocks to configure the appropriate CCD's and FEP's for the upcoming observations were completed and tested overnight and will be uplinked during additional real-time passes provided by DSN.

The new mission schedule began operation on-board at 12AM 10/16 as planned and is proceeding nominally. The spacecraft systems continued to operate nominally.
